Nutritional Snapshot: The Goodness Within
Apples are rich in an array of vitamins, minerals, and dietary fiber, making them an excellent addition to a balanced diet. A medium-sized apple contains about 95 calories and provides a good dose of vitamin C, potassium, and antioxidants. Additionally, apples are a great source of dietary fiber, both soluble and insoluble, which aids digestion and promotes feelings of satiety.
Heart Health Hero: Protecting the Cardiovascular System
One of the standout benefits of apples is their positive impact on heart health. Studies have shown that regular apple consumption is associated with a reduced risk of heart disease, stroke, and high blood pressure. This is attributed to the presence of antioxidants, particularly flavonoids and polyphenols, which help lower cholesterol levels, reduce inflammation, and improve overall cardiovascular function. Fiber-Fueled Digestion: Keeping Things Moving Smoothly
Apples are packed with dietary fiber, making them an excellent natural remedy for digestive woes. The insoluble fiber found in apple skin adds bulk to stool, promoting regular bowel movements and preventing constipation. Meanwhile, the soluble fiber, known as pectin, acts as a prebiotic, nourishing the beneficial bacteria in your gut. A healthy digestive system not only improves nutrient absorption but also supports overall well-being.

Brain-Boosting Fuel: Enhancing Cognitive Function
An apple a day may not only keep the doctor away but also support brain health. Apples are rich in antioxidants, particularly quercetin, which has been shown to protect brain cells against oxidative stress and inflammation. Regular apple consumption has been associated with a reduced risk of neurodegenerative disorders such as Alzheimer’s disease and age-related cognitive decline.
